Data cleaning will involve checking for duplicates, missing values, and impossible entries (e.g., negative ages or out-of-range scale scores). Minimal missing data will be addressed via listwise deletion, while more substantial or non-random missingness will be handled using multiple imputations. Scale scores will be computed according to the manuals, including reverse-scoring of items where applicable. Outliers and inconsistent responses will be identified using item-level patterns, z-scores (|z| > 3.29), and Mahalanobis distance for multivariate analyses. Each flagged case will be reviewed, and decisions to retain, transform, or remove outliers were documented. Distributions of variables will be examined, and skewed variables were considered for transformation or analyzed using robust methods. A finalized analysis dataset will be created, and a log of all data cleaning decisions, including rationale and timestamps, will be maintained
